Cissy as "Gainsborough Lady" in Ivory Taffeta Gown from "Formal Gowns" Series, 1957

Description
20" (51 cm.) Auburn hair drawn back from face into a cluster of curls at her nape. Wearing crisp ivory taffeta gown with very full sleeves accented with large shaded pink flowers which match the flowers on her wide-brimmed aqua woven picture hat, aqua velvet sash and hat streamers with tiny rosebud tassels, hooped pale yellow taffeta petticoat with rose buds, panties, stockings, silver cross-strap shoes, rhinestone earrings, sapphire ring, pearl bracelet. Excellent condition. Alexander, model 2176, from "Formal Gowns" series of 1957, described as "radiant in a gown of whispering taffeta".
